Afaik the ohm meter flashes when the coil resistance you are using cannot be regulated to the power you have set the mod to. It will just dump straight battery voltatage to the atty therefore not a regulated vape.Is it dangerous to use it when the ohm meter flashes?
Is it dangerous to use it when the ohm meter flashes?
Afaik the ohm meter flashes when the coil resistance you are using cannot be regulated to the power you have set the mod to. It will just dump straight battery voltatage to the atty therefore not a regulated vape.

Like this chart but the other way round?As I understand it, the minimum output voltage of this mod is 4 volts. So, if you ohms flashes it is just telling you you are in fact vaping at 4 volts and not at the wattage you have set. The wattage you have set it too low so it will instead use the minimum wattage required for 4 volts, which is dependant on you coil resistance. Here is a table I have drawn up to show what your coil resistance must be if you have a specific minimum wattage in mind:
